Accounts Receivable & Billing Manager

A growing multi-site stone fabrication company serving customers throughout the Carolinas is expanding its finance team and seeking an experienced Accounts Receivable & Billing Manager. This is a hands-on leadership opportunity for someone who enjoys creating structure, improving processes, and taking ownership of the full billing and collections function.

The ideal candidate will bring strong Accounts Receivable experience, leadership capabilities, and a process-improvement mindset.

Key Responsibilities
  • Lead the day-to-day Accounts Receivable and billing operations across Retail, Commercial, Cabinets, Builder Relations, and Design Studio accounts.
  • Oversee invoicing, collections, aging, and month-end activities while ensuring billing accuracy and timeliness.
  • Review invoices for accuracy and completeness prior to customer distribution.
  • Prepare Accounts Receivable forecasts and provide leadership with visibility into expected cash flow and collections.
  • Develop, implement, and maintain standard operating procedures, training materials, and workflow documentation.
  • Train, coach, and mentor Accounts Receivable team members while supporting professional development.
  • Manage the billing lifecycle for commercial projects, including lien waivers and collection activities.
  • Monitor outstanding receivables and develop strategies to improve collections and reduce aging balances.
  • Partner with Accounting, Sales, Order Entry, Installers, Warranty, and Commercial Operations to ensure accurate and timely billing.
  • Identify opportunities to improve processes, increase efficiency, and strengthen internal controls.
Qualifications
  • 5+ years of Accounts Receivable, billing, or collections experience, including supervisory or team-lead responsibilities.
  • Strong knowledge of invoicing, collections, aging management, and month-end close processes.
  • Proficiency with Quick Books and Microsoft Excel.
  • Experience with construction, fabrication, project-based billing, or commercial projects is highly preferred.
  • Experience managing or mentoring Accounts Receivable staff.
  • Strong attention to detail and a high level of accuracy.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
  • Proven ability to improve processes, establish procedures, and create structure in a growing environment.
  • Strong organizational and time-management skills with the ability to manage multiple priorities.
